Penn State Basketball Schedule: Mark Your Calendars for an Action-Packed Season

The basketball team is gearing up for their upcoming season with the first exhibition game against Dayton just around the corner. The regular season will kick off against Fairfield on November 3rd. The program has released the tip-off times and broadcast/streaming networks for all their games this season, providing fans with the schedule details they need to follow the action.
Throughout November, the basketball team will be playing on football Saturdays, including a game against Providence at the Mohegan Sun in Connecticut on November 22nd at 4:00 PM EST. Fans may find themselves multitasking on Senior Day against Nebraska to catch both the football and basketball games happening simultaneously.
One highlight of the schedule is the Palestra game in Philly against Illinois on January 3rd at 7:00 PM EST on B1G Network. The Nittany Lions will have six weekend conference home games at the Bryce Jordan Center, starting with Michigan State on December 13th at noon on B1G Network. Other weekend matchups include games against Minnesota, USC, and Iowa, all broadcast on various networks.
The west coast swing will feature late tip-off times, with a 10:30 PM EST game at Washington on February 11th followed by a Saturday afternoon game at Oregon at 3:00 PM EST. Both games will be broadcast on B1G Network, giving fans a chance to catch the action even from afar.
